Output 9dd80cd202cfa2bba240cb412e501fc47fe00470da8a8331a04d9cb96cfb8bb0:5

value
19794643
script pubkey
OP_0 OP_PUSHBYTES_32 e2ae77a3484690ebf6420e03a35bbc0deffc17ff3b109bcf345b624a5f8bdb28
address
bc1qu2h80g6gg6gwhajzpcp6xkauphhlc9ll8vgfhne5td3y5hutmv5qgdjz2f
transaction
9dd80cd202cfa2bba240cb412e501fc47fe00470da8a8331a04d9cb96cfb8bb0
confirmations
231275
spent
true